    This game treats you like a child.
    When you begin the first mission of the game, you will notice that you have around 500 rounds for your AR. Why? because like a parent putting too much padding on their child going to the park, the game is putting in measures to ensure that the player is able to finish the mission. All of the good cover is on the side you approach from, and none of the enemies will attempt a flank. By holding your hand this much, the game ceases to have any difficulty, so it is inflated with fake difficulty, such as bullet sponge enemies, who in the second mission, will take 4-5 headshots to kill.
    The game also handles all of the movement in combat for you, making it essentially one step above an on-rails shooter. When in combat, to move to the next point of cover, all you have to do is look at it, and hold space. This is a cover based shooter. In a good cover based shooter, your placement matters; you need to have the angle advantage on your enemies, so getting to a good position is what you want to do. Getting their in other games requires thought, and can be tricky. In this game you hold space. By taking the cover mechanics out, and replacing it with, Hold Space mechanics, then they have taken "Cover based" out of the name, making it just a shooter. A shooter where the shooting itself is boring. When one of the games core mechanics is being taken care of by holding space, and one is just shoot the guy till he die, then what is left? A husk. The game feels lifeless, and I cannot see any love that has been put into the game. I pity any Dev who calls this game their magnum opus.

    Also the UI is really ugly

    Been following the development of the game as much as the devs have been willing to share. At first, it looked like it was going to be a refined version of the first game to be able to sell the good quality product they had achieved after 3 years of content patches, but in reality, what we got was much better.

    This sequel is a rework from the ground up of the play experience, core mechanics and gameplay.

    In terms of the play experience there's a much bigger variety of possible and interesting things to do, specially in the endgame. In the campaign, since the main missions were designed with endgame in mind they're really varied, which makes the campaign experience fluid and not repetitive, a thing that's also helped by the fact that secondary missions are as close as they can get to main missions, unique scenery and gameplay all around. This game secondary missions feel more main-y than other games' main missions.

    Landscape and scenery wise I expected Washington to be a dull place for a game, but it turns out it was not. It's really varied which is essential to keep you engaged and feel like you're mixing things up and it's also filled up to the brim with stuff to pick up and discover. And god, is it beautiful as well.

    In terms of mechanics, skills have improved a ton since the first title. Even though some of them still lack identity (new pulse, maybe firefly?) the rest feel awesome and make a real impact on-use. The gunplay is HELL OF A LOT better this time around, as is the sound in general and the music and gunshots in particular.

    I'm giving this game a 10, but we don't really know yet if it'll be a 10-game. It'll all depend on the content patches and how frequent and hefty they are. The base they got to work with is infinetely times better than what they got with TD1, and they got it to work back there, I hope they're exploit the hell out of this masterpiece of a release build.

    If I had to pinpoint anything negative, I still don't like the solo experience in the Dark Zones, since even though there's supposed to be a system in place that would try to match you versus other solo players, it doesn't seem to work all that well and it can be annoying to be in a DZ with a a couple of 4 man groups in it, you feel like you're forced to PVE.

    Long story short I like this game.

    Considering the fact that I run on a set up with a very old cpu, optimization is very decent, mainly thanks to ability to change a great number of settings which is rare

    As for gameplay I’m not a fan of cover based shooters but overall shooting mechanics feel satisfying. And progression system gives an opportunity to adjust your build to your preferences. Speaking about “bullet sponge” concerns of a big number of players , I didn’t notice it much during early access as common “red bar” enemies may be killed sometimes in number of two for one clip of my gold ak-m.

    Also need to mention that in pvp some guns had been balanced since beta which is good news.

    As for cons of the game, for a new player it may seem complicated at first as the number of player stats are dumped at you without much explanation how it is better to manage them, but after some time it becomes more understandable.

    Looks like microtransactions are just cosmetics (as for now) that maybe earned at random through finding them in missions and open world, and also through loot boxes, that are also earned for leveling/completing certain objectives.

    Overall, Division 2 is a refreshing game after recent fails of some looter-shooter and open-world games that I will not name.
